The Benefits of a Micro Market Modular System
Micro market vending is a modern form of self-service retail. A Micro Market Modular System bridges the gap between staffed catering facilities and traditional vending machines, offering more choice and flexibility.
Businesses can install micro markets in offices for employees or even customers. They also work well in hospitals, schools, leisure centres, and shopping centres. Any public or private building can benefit.
But why choose a micro market? What makes this model better than regular vending machines?
The Advantages of Micro Market Vending
Broad Product Range
Vending machines remain limited by their design. They can easily handle snacks and drinks. But perishable foods, bakery items, hot meals, and frozen goods often create problems.
Many companies feel forced to compromise on variety. Micro markets solve this issue. They combine open chillers, freezers, shelving, microwaves, and kiosks. This setup supports a much wider range of products.
You can also offer utensils, plates, condiments, and napkins for convenience. Micro markets can even stock non-food items, creating extra income streams.
This versatility helps businesses meet diverse tastes and dietary needs. As a result, micro markets often have a wider appeal.
Flexible Installation
Every workplace has a unique layout. Micro markets utilise modular designs, allowing you to tailor them to your specific space.
Small areas may only need a fridge, a shelf, and a payment kiosk. Larger spaces can support multiple units, expanding product choice even more.
Self-Service Model
Many businesses love the self-service approach. It reduces the need for staff, which lowers costs. The availability of food and beverages is around the clock, and so convenient.
For offices, hospitals, and schools, a micro market requires a one-off investment. After that, you only need regular restocking and maintenance. The model is simple and efficient.
Tech-Assisted Efficiency
Contactless payment technology has transformed self-service retail. Chipped cards, NFC, and biometrics make checkout fast and secure.
This technology keeps queues short and reduces wasted time. Micro markets also suit the ‘always on the go’ mindset of younger employees.
Workplace Culture
A micro market can enhance your workplace culture in several ways.
First, offering diverse and nutritious choices shows you care about your team’s wellbeing. This strengthens your reputation as a considerate employer.
Second, in-house food options encourage employees to stay on site during breaks. That helps build stronger connections among colleagues.
Third, healthier food can improve mood and energy throughout the day.
